Design and manufacturing techniques/methodologies with which I am familiar include:

Parametric Modeling, Engineering Drawings, and GD&T per ASME Y14.5-2008

FDM Rapid Prototyping (3D Printing)

Anodic Coatings per MIL-A-8625

CNC Milling and Turning/Manual Milling and Turning

CNC Laser Cutting and Engraving

Sheet Metal Forming and Bending, Specifically for Electronics Enclosures

Powder Metal Sintering

Electrical Discharge Machining (EDM)

 

I modify my own prototypes and don't hesitate to roll up my sleeves. I am able to use a manual mill and lathe, as well as operate a 3D printer (Objet Alaris 30U). I also have experience with soldering for electronics, as well as welding (SMAW, GMAW, and GTAW).
